#4b200a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b200a is composed of 29.4% red, 12.5%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 20.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 16.7%. #4b200a color hex could be obtained by blending #964014 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#4b200a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b200a has RGB values of R:75, G:32,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.87,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4923402.

Shades and Tints of #4b200a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b200a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2a27 is the less saturated color, while #551d00 is the most saturated one.
